  • 11/19 De-Risking Your Business Model

    Scientists test their technology over and over again before bringing it to market.  Why not do the same thing for your business model? Learn how to spot potential challenges before you go to market, and engage the allies you need to make your venture a success!

    The Technology Incubation Program (TIP) would like to invite you to a learning and networking event for current and would-be CEOs of for-profit start-ups where we will discuss how to test the assumptions one has unwittingly built into his/her business model.
